Calvary in the Bible
Meaning: the place of a skull
Exact Match
And when they came to a place called Calvary, there they crucified him, and the malefactors, the one on the right hand, and the other on the left.
And He was bearing His cross. And He went out into a place called Calvary, which in Hebrew is called Golgotha.

Calvary » Also called golgotha, place where jesus was crucified
And when they were come to a place called Golgotha, that is to say,
and they brought Him to a place called Golgotha, which is, being interpreted, the place of a scull.
And when they were come to the place which is called Calvary, there they crucified Him and the malefactors: one on his right hand and the other on his left.
And they took Jesus, and led Him away. And He went out, bearing his cross, into a place called the place of a scull, in Hebrew Golgotha:
